前端开发框架与网络应用性能优化是现代前端开发的重要研究领域。随着网络技术的快速发展和用户需求的变化,如何提升网页加载速度、用户体验和应用程序的性能变得尤为重要。以下是对前端开发框架和网络应用性能优化的
网络安全是当今互联网时代一个至关重要的问题,无论是个人还是企业,都需要构建一个稳健的网络防护系统来保护自己的数据和隐私。编程是实现这一系统的关键手段之一。以下是一些关于如何构建稳健的网络防护系统的建议:
一、了解网络安全基础
在构建网络防护系统之前,首先需要了解网络安全的基础知识和概念,包括常见的网络攻击方式(如钓鱼攻击、恶意软件等)、网络协议安全、加密技术等。此外,还需要了解各种网络安全法规和标准,以便遵循最佳实践和标准来构建防护系统。
二、使用编程技能构建防护系统
编程技能在构建网络防护系统中发挥着重要作用。以下是一些关键方面:
1. 开发防火墙和入侵检测系统:通过编程实现防火墙和入侵检测系统,可以实时监测网络流量并拦截恶意流量。
2. 构建安全协议:通过编程实现安全协议(如HTTPS、SSL等),确保数据在传输过程中的安全性。
3. 开发恶意软件检测和清除工具:利用编程技能开发恶意软件检测和清除工具,以应对潜在的威胁。
三、实施关键防护措施
在构建网络防护系统时,需要实施以下关键防护措施:
1. 访问控制:实施严格的访问控制策略,确保只有授权的用户可以访问系统和数据。
2. 数据加密:对重要数据进行加密,以防止数据在传输和存储过程中被泄露。
3. 定期更新和补丁管理:定期更新系统和软件,并及时修复安全漏洞,以提高系统的安全性。
4. 安全审计和监控:定期进行安全审计和监控,以检测潜在的安全风险并采取相应的措施。
四、应对新兴威胁和挑战
为了应对新兴的网络威胁和挑战,需要持续关注网络安全领域的最新动态和技术发展。此外,还需要加强网络安全意识培训,提高员工的安全意识和应对能力。
五、整合现有资源和技术
在构建网络防护系统时,应充分利用现有资源和技术。例如,可以利用现有的安全工具、服务和技术来增强系统的安全性。此外,还可以与其他组织合作,共享安全信息和资源,以提高整体的网络安全水平。
总之,构建稳健的网络防护系统需要综合运用网络安全知识和编程技能。通过实施关键防护措施、应对新兴威胁和挑战以及整合现有资源和技术,可以大大提高系统的安全性并保护数据和隐私。
标签:网络防护系统